She'd been in the arena for six weeks. Six glorious weeks of non-stop sugar, singing, and the world just going mad. There were several times that Cindy almost decided to get out of this arena herself, but she figured that she wasn't that desperate. She could outlast everyone else. She could. But she didn't want to. There were others she'd like to see win this one.
But that didn't mean she was looking for a way out. No, definitely not. She'd lost too many people so far. Harley, dying in her arms. Poor Shion, the kid she'd told that she would protect, dead within that first fifteen minutes or so. Topher had died after she'd partnered with him, and she was still upset about that. Poor Brains. And Holiday. Cindy had nothing to do with the actual killing, but they still shouldn't have happened. If she'd been around when she needed to be.
Cindy had been close to tears, but no more. Now, right now, she was stationed by the falls. It hampered her from hearing if someone was close by, but it also hampered the singing. So she'd made her choice, as she rested there for a little while.
